The top five locations for white water rafting in Wales; 

1. The River Dee in Llangollen is the perfect place to go white water rafting. This river will take you to the charming Horseshoe Falls and is known as one of the best in the UK for white water rafting. This adventure will take you onto the rapids such as Serpents Tail, Tombstones and Town Falls and makes sure you’ll leave with wonderful memories.

3. Who knew that you'd be able to go white water rafting on the edge of Cardiff, the Welsh capital? Raft the stunning Brecon Beacons National Park on the River Usk. The Usk rises in the North-Western edge of the Brecons and flows south-easterly through south Wales majestic valleys. The River Rhondda features long stretches of tough rapids, falls and difficult to predict waves – it is one hell of a ride. The River Wye hugs the edge of the national park is more sedate and relaxing in parts. These Rivers are not dependant on water releases from dams.

4. Raft the River Tryweryn through Snowdonia National Park with grade three sections. Boulders have been placed in strategic locations to make the river safer and create pools for play. Located near Bala, the National White Water Centre features approximately 5.5 miles of a natural river, making it one of the longest rafting bodies of water in the United Kingdom. This adventure will take you to the best sections of the Tryweryn River, where you can marvel at the beauty of Snowdonia National Park with its otters, raptors and sublime scenery.

5. How about Cardiff International White Water Rafting Centre? It is a world-class artificial white water centre catering for professional and leisure standards. The facility has many holes, curves and tons of waves to test your nerve. For those who consider themselves 'professional', lets book Friday night sessions when the centre turns up the volume and turns CIWW into a raging torrent of angry white water.
